Pros & Cons

Pros

  • Wireless Freedom: Eliminates the need for physical HDMI cables, allowing greater flexibility in placing devices and displays. Ideal for presentations and setups where running cables is difficult or aesthetically undesirable.
  • Long Transmission Range: 165ft transmission range provides a significant reach, enabling connections between rooms or across larger spaces.
  • Plug-and-Play Simplicity (Generally): Once paired, the device typically operates with minimal configuration. Simply plug and play for most common applications.
  • Relatively Affordable: Compared to other wireless HDMI solutions, the MINIX H1 offers a competitive price point, making it an accessible option.
  • Compact and Portable Design: The dongle form factor makes it easy to transport and use in different locations.
  • Supports 2.4GHz/5GHz Band: While both bands are used for transmission, using the 5 GHz band can help mitigate interference from other devices.

Cons

  • 1080p Resolution Limit: While sufficient for many applications, the resolution limit to 1080p might be restrictive for users with 4K displays or who require higher image fidelity. This is a common limitation of older wireless HDMI solutions.
  • Potential Latency/Lag: Wireless transmission inherently introduces latency which could be problematic for gaming or real-time interactive applications. While MINIX claims low latency, user experiences may vary depending on network conditions and interference.
  • Image Quality Degradation Compared to Wired: Expect a slight reduction in image quality compared to a direct HDMI connection, particularly noticeable with HDR content or complex scenes. Wireless compression can impact color accuracy and sharpness.
  • Susceptibility to Interference: Like all wireless devices, the H1 is vulnerable to interference from other electronic devices operating on the 2.4GHz band (e.g., microwaves, Bluetooth devices).
  • Setup Complexity: Initial setup and pairing of the transmitter and receiver can sometimes be challenging, potentially requiring firmware updates or troubleshooting.
  • Limited Audio Format Support: May have limitations in supporting certain advanced audio formats compared to wired HDMI connections.

The MINIX H1 offers a compelling solution for wirelessly extending HDMI signals, particularly appealing to users needing flexibility and long-range transmission. While the image quality might not match wired connections at higher resolutions or with demanding content, it provides significant convenience for presentations, home entertainment setups where cabling is impractical, and connecting devices in various rooms. The price point makes it a reasonably accessible entry into wireless HDMI technology.
